Project Manager, Aviation Regulatory Programs - Toronto

Key Responsibilities 

  • Reporting to the Director of Aviation, this position is responsible for leading and continually developing the SMS Program and related Quality Assurance Audit program for WSP and its Clients. This is achieved by performing Quality Assurance Audits at airports across Canada, performing hazard identification and risk assessments, updating operational manuals, keeping on top of regulatory requirements, and acting as a subject matter expert for WSP aviation team members.
  • Prime responsibilities relate to managing the Safety Management System and providing project coordination and support to the Aviation Planning group. Some travel will be required to support on site Quality Assurance Audits, performance of Safety Management System training, and to perform Hazard Identification and Risk Assessments. Since work does involve site specific visits and is safety sensitive, Candidate shall possess a Radio Telephone Operators Certificate and shall be familiar with typical AVOP procedures as work on active runways is required.
  • Key accountabilities include but are not limited to: Prepare budgets, execute work plans and foster business development related to safety management systems and regulatory programs at airports throughout Canada and abroad.
  • Support Aviation Planning Team; provide peer review and insight / interpretation into regulatory requirements. Act as a Project Coordinator as required.
  • SMS Training including acting as a Project Manager, content developer, and trainer related to SMS. Training is normally focused on SMS awareness, performance of investigation and analysis, and providing an understanding of human factor.
  • Facilitate and deliver Hazard Identification and Risk Assessments for Client(s). Typical duties include organization, facilitate HIRA process while preparing deliverables including but not limited to HIRA workshop materials, safety case for the Accountable Executive, Public Interest arguments, exemption request forms, and correspondence on behalf of the Client(s). Role may also be to act as a Subject Matter Expert depending on hazard and risk being analyzed.
  • Quality Assurance Auditing - Act as Audit Lead and Audit Team Member while performing compliance, conformance audits of airport systems and processes while reviewing all certificated operations including; Wildlife and Emergency Planning, Airport Operations Manual, TP312 Standards, SMS, Obligations of the Operator, Winter Maintenance, and, where applicable, Aircraft Rescue & Fire Fighting. Responsibilities include the development of the audit plans, checklists, documentation reviews and performing interviews with airport staff.
  • Provide a full comprehensive review of Client(s) SMS program(s) including training, and documentation records applicable to certificated operations.
  • Analyze findings as a result of a Transport Canada Program Validation Inspection (PVI), and/or internal Quality Assurance Audit.
  • Ability to write reports including preparing audit reports and preparing findings as the result of an audit. Prepare proposals including the identification of time, scope and cost.
  • Review and interpret drawings in relation to the support of the Aviation Planning Team.
  • Perform audit site reviews and inspections with regard to aerodrome facilities and services including visual aids to navigation (lights, signs, markings, etc.), physical characteristics (runways, taxiways, aprons, etc.)
  • Ensure familiarity with all current and proposed regulatory requirements.
Qualifications
  • Post-secondary education in aviation or 5 years combined equivalent aviation work experience.
  • Work experience should include at least 3 years direct SMS experience in an aviation organization.
  • Knowledgeable with airport operational documents associated with a certified airport, including but not limited to Airport Operations Manuals, Safety Management Manual, Emergency Response Plans, Wildlife Management Plans, Winter Maintenance Manuals, Apron Management Plans, AVOP Manual.
  • Knowledge with NAV CANADA practices, procedures including publications such as NOTAM procedures Manual, Canada Flight Supplement, and Canada Air Pilot.
  • Knowledge of TP312 3rd, 4th and 5th Editions.
  • Knowledge of Canadian Aviation Regulations.
  • Knowledge of airside standards and practices.
  • Knowledge of winter maintenance procedures.
  • Proficient with all Microsoft Office applications including databases, spreadsheets, and in creating presentations.
  • Knowledge of Microsoft Project is a benefit.
  • Knowledge of Aviation Planning and Project Management is an asset.
